K8S进阶实践 之 ETCD常用操作

一、etcd的作用

Etcd是Kubernetes集群中的一个十分重要的组件,用于保存集群所有的网络配置和对象的状态信息

二、etcd的常用操作命令

1、将etcdctl命令复制到hosts主机

K8S进阶实践  之  ETCD常用操作

2、查看etcd集群的成员节点

$ etcdctl --endpoints=https://[127.0.0.1]:2379 --cacert=/etc/kubernetes/pki/etcd/ca.crt --cert=/etc/kubernetes/pki/etcd/healthcheck-client.crt --key=/etc/kubernetes/pki/etcd/healthcheck-client.key member list -w table

备注: --cacert为客户端连接etcd所需的证书信息
K8S进阶实践  之  ETCD常用操作

为了便于操作操作,将该证书alias别名,

alias etcdctl='etcdctl --endpoints=https://[127.0.0.1]:2379 --cacert=/etc/kubernetes/pki/etcd/ca.crt --cert=/etc/kubernetes/pki/etcd/healthcheck-client.crt --key=/etc/kubernetes/pki/etcd/healthcheck-client.key'

$ etcdctl member list -w table (简写)

3、查看节点的状态信息

K8S进阶实践  之  ETCD常用操作

猜你喜欢

转载自blog.51cto.com/12965094/2645436